*** Settings ***
Documentation === Robot Framework Magik keywords running and evaluating MUnit tests ===
...
... MUnit results are logged to separated files. Robot report includes for failed MUnit test runs \ link to open the log file.
...
... These keywords are tested against [https://github.com/OpenSmallworld/munit|OpenSmallworld MUnit], but other MUnit versions should be usable in same way.
...
... == Sample Workflow ==
... - load MUnit base classes - `Prepare MUnit` (suite setup )
... - load magik module with (MUnit) tests and run test - `Load Module with MUnit Tests and Start Test Runner`
... - evaluate log file - `Evaluate MUnit Text Log`, `Evaluate MUnit XML Log`
...
... Sample see [../examples/run_munit_tests.robot|run_munit_tests]
...
... == Used MUnit Runner ==
...
... MUnit test runs are started using *A_RUNNER.run_in_new_stream()*. Results are written directly into a log file. Content of this log file will be evaluated by Robot . The log file themself can be directly deleted afterwards by Robot, or keeped for further error analysis or import into test management tools.
...
... Currently supported runner
... - *test_runner* - simple text output, documents failed test and error with full tracebacks, good for error analysis
... - \ *xml_test_runner* - creates [https://llg.cubic.org/docs/junit/|JUnit XML reporting file format] - documents each munit testcase with its status
...
... Unsupported (future task):
... - filter tests to run by MUnit aspects
...
... == Customisations ==
...
... Use [http://robotframework.org/robotframework/latest/RobotFrameworkUserGuide.html#variable-files|variable files] to customize the MUnit keywords. Sample see [../resources/params/variables_sw43_cbg.py|resources/params/variables_sw43_cbg.py]
...
... *Loading other MUnit Product and / or additional test code*
... - Define a load file like \ [../resources/magik/load_opensmallworld_munit_43.magik|resources/magik/load_opensmallworld_munit_43.magik] and adjust ``${ROBOT_MUNIT_LOADFILE}`` in variable file
...
... *Timeout, when Loading MUnit Product / test code \ - `Prepare MUnit`*
... - define / extend ``${ROBOT_MUNIT_MAX_LOAD_WAIT}`` in variable file
...
... *Timeout, when Running MUnit Tests - `Run MUnit Testsuite Logging to File`*
... - if several tests affected, define / extend \ ``${ROBOT_MUNIT_MAX_RUN_WAIT}`` in variable file
... - if just one test affected, assign specific ``${max_run_wait}`` argument, when test calls the keyword
...

Resource robot_magik_base.robot
Library OperatingSystem
Library XML
*** Variables ***
${ROBOT_MUNIT_LOADFILE} ${CURDIR}${/}magik${/}load_opensmallworld_munit_43.magik # Defines default magik file loading munit base modules and other required base test code - modules with tests should be loaded separately
${ROBOT_MUNIT_LOG_DIR} ${OUTPUT_DIR}
${ROBOT_MUNIT_MAX_LOAD_WAIT} 20s # Defines default max wait time for prompt, when loading munit code (files or modules)
${ROBOT_MUNIT_MAX_RUN_WAIT} 30s # Defines default max wait time for prompt, when running a munit test suite
${ROBOT_MUNIT_LOG_OK_REGEXP} OK.*(\\d+).*(\\d+).*\\] # regular expression searching a OK MUnit test result in a text log
${ROBOT_MUNIT_LOG_KO_REGEXP} Tests run: (\\d+).*(\\d+).*(\\d+).*(\\d+)
*** Keywords ***
Prepare MUnit
[Arguments] ${munit_load_file}=${ROBOT_MUNIT_LOADFILE} ${munit_dir}=
[Documentation] Setup for MUnit tests. Loads file ${munit_load_file} to import required MUnit functions and additional required magik functions
...
... if ${munit_dir} is defined, environment variable ``ROBOT_MUNIT_DIR`` is set, before loading ${munit_load_file}
Run Keyword If '${munit_dir}' != '' Execute Magik Command system.putenv("ROBOT_MUNIT_DIR", "${munit_dir}")
${out}= Load Magik File ${munit_load_file} max_load_wait=${ROBOT_MUNIT_MAX_LOAD_WAIT}
[Return] ${out}
Load Module with MUnit Tests and Start Test Runner
[Arguments] ${module_with_tests} ${log_extension}=log ${log_dir}=${ROBOT_MUNIT_LOG_DIR}
[Documentation] Loads ${module_with_tests} , creates MUnit test suite with all test classes defined in ${module_with_tests} and starts MUnit test runner
...
... test runner results will be written into log file in ${munit_log_dir} and returned for separate evaluation.
...
... see also `Run Munit Testsuite Logging to File`
${out}= Load Magik Module ${module_with_tests} max_load_wait=${ROBOT_MUNIT_MAX_LOAD_WAIT}
${swv}= Get Smallworld Version
${testsuite_name}= Set Variable ${module_with_tests}_${swv}
Store Magik Object ${testsuite_name} test_suite.new_from_module(:${module_with_tests} )
${munit_log_content}= Run MUnit Testsuite Logging to File ${testsuite_name} ${log_extension} ${log_dir}
[Return] ${munit_log_content}
Run MUnit Testsuite Logging to File
[Arguments] ${testsuite_name} ${log_extension}=log ${log_dir}=${ROBOT_MUNIT_LOG_DIR} ${max_run_wait}=${ROBOT_MUNIT_MAX_RUN_WAIT}
[Documentation] Start test runner for MUnit suite stored in global hash_table with key ${testsuite_name} and logs to file in ${log_dir}.
...
... - ${log_extension} defines kind of test runner - *xml_test_runner* is used when _xml_ otherwise (default) *test_runner*
... - log file will include the ${testsuite_name}
...
... Waits ${max_run_wait} (e.g. 10s) till test runner must be finished.
...
... returns log file \ content for separate evaluation.
...
... == Site effect ==
...
... extends connection timeout to ${max_run_wait} and switch it back to default ``${CLI_TIMEOUT}`` during the teardown.
...
... == Info ==
...
... Uses [https://github.com/OpenSmallworld/munit|OpenSmallworld MUnit] method *A_RUNNER.run_in_new_stream()*
...
... This creates a new stream and a new runner which is not given back. It is not possible to this runner directly for test results. The log file name must be evaluated for this.
${test_runner}= Set Variable If '${log_extension}' == 'xml' xml_test_runner test_runner
${logfile_pattern}= Set Variable ${log_dir}${/}*${testsuite_name}*.${log_extension}
Remove File ${logfile_pattern}
${tsm_exp}= Build Magik Object Expression ${testsuite_name}
${tr_exp}= Store Magik Object tr ${test_runner}.new(_unset, :output_dir, "${log_dir}", :output_format, "${log_extension}", :output_identifier, "${testsuite_name}" )
Set Timeout ${max_run_wait}
Write Magik Command ${tr_exp}.run_in_new_stream(${tsm_exp})
${out}= Read Magik Output ${tr_exp}.run_in_new_stream(${tsm_exp})
${munit_log_fname}= Get MUnit Log File Name from Test Runner Output ${out} ${testsuite_name}
${munit_log_content}= Get File ${munit_log_fname}
[Teardown] Set Timeout ${CLI_TIMEOUT}
[Return] ${munit_log_content}
Get MUnit Log File Name from Test Runner Output
[Arguments] ${trunner_output} ${testsuite_name}
[Documentation] internal keyword, searching in ${trunner_output} the log file name - line including ${testsuite_name}
...
... The file name will be returned \ and is stored as test variable ``${CURRENT_MUNIT_LOG_FNAME}`` (see `Delete Current MUnit Log`).
...
... Keywords fails , when
... - no line with ${testsuite_name} can be found in ${trunner_output}
... - in ${trunner_output} detected file name does not exist
...
... === Remarks ===
...
... unfortunately \ \ [https://github.com/OpenSmallworld/munit|OpenSmallworld MUnit] method *base_test_runner.new_stream()* does not store the log file name in a property, it just write it out to the current terminal. And this can be surrounded with same noice. Sample
...
... | \ "C:\\Temp\\RIDE39_945pl.d\\test__munit_base_tests_4308__test_suite__erebus.log"
... | \ **** Warnung: Changing nature of unset
... | \ \ \ \ \ \ global_changing_nature()
... | \ **** Warnung: unset
... | \ \ \ \ \ \ warning()
... | \ unset
${matching_lines}= Get Lines Containing String ${trunner_output} ${testsuite_name}
Should Not Be Empty ${matching_lines} MUnit Log file name can not be extracted from ${trunner_output}
${first_matching_line}= Get Line ${matching_lines} 0
${munit_log_fname}= Remove String Using Regexp ${first_matching_line} (^")|("\\s*$)
File Should Exist ${munit_log_fname}
Set Test Variable ${CURRENT_MUNIT_LOG_FNAME} ${munit_log_fname}
${log_path_parts}= Split Path ${munit_log_fname}
${log_fname_parts}= Split Extension ${log_path_parts}[1]
${log_ex_name}= Set Variable If 'xml' in '${log_fname_parts}[1]' MUnit xml log MUnit text log
Set Test Variable ${CURRENT_MUNIT_LOG_LINK} <a href="./${log_path_parts}[1]">${log_ex_name}</a>
[Return] ${munit_log_fname}
Evaluate MUnit Text Log
[Arguments] ${munit_text_log} ${expected_failures}=0 ${expected_errors}=0 ${testsuite_name}=
[Documentation] Ensure, that ${munit_text_log} includes only expected number of errors or failures.
...
... Will PASS, when expected number of errors / failures have occured or when no error AND no failure occured.
${result_line_ok}= Get Lines Matching Regexp ${munit_text_log} ${ROBOT_MUNIT_LOG_OK_REGEXP}
${result_line_failures}= Get Lines Matching Regexp ${munit_text_log} ${ROBOT_MUNIT_LOG_KO_REGEXP}
${results_count_ok}= Get Regexp Matches ${result_line_ok} (\\d+)
${results_count_failures}= Get Regexp Matches ${result_line_failures} (\\d+)
Run Keyword If ${results_count_failures} Should Be True ${results_count_failures}[2] == ${expected_failures} and ${results_count_failures}[3] == ${expected_errors} *HTML* ${test_suite_name} unexpected number of errors / failures in ${CURRENT_MUNIT_LOG_LINK} - ${result_line_failures}
Run Keyword If ${results_count_failures} Set Test Message *HTML* MUnit reports expected failures ${testsuite_name} - ${result_line_failures}<br> append=${TRUE}
Run Keyword If ${results_count_ok} Set Test Message *HTML* MUnit results OK ${testsuite_name} - ${result_line_ok}<br> append=${TRUE}
Evaluate MUnit XML Log
[Arguments] ${munit_xml_log} ${expected_failures}=0 ${expected_errors}=0 ${testsuite_name}=
[Documentation] Ensure, that ${munit_xml_log} includes only expected number of failed testcases.
...
... Will FAIL, when ${munit_xml_log} includes
... - no testcase OR no passed testcase OR \ number of failed testcases is not expected
${count_testcases}= Get Element Count ${munit_xml_log} */testcase
${count_passed}= Get Element Count ${munit_xml_log} */testcase[@status="Passed"]
Should Be True ${count_testcases} > 0 ${test_suite_name} no testcases found in MUnit xml log
Should Be True ${count_passed} > 0 *HTML* ${test_suite_name} no passed testcases found in ${CURRENT_MUNIT_LOG_LINK}
${count_errors}= Get Element Count ${munit_xml_log} */testcase/error
${count_failures}= Get Element Count ${munit_xml_log} */testcase/failure
Should Be True ${expected_failures} == ${count_failures} and ${expected_errors} == ${count_errors} *HTML* ${test_suite_name} unexpected number of \ ${count_errors} errors and ${count_failures} failures \ in ${CURRENT_MUNIT_LOG_LINK}
Set Test Message *HTML* \ MUnit results OK \ ${test_suite_name} - \ ${count_testcases} testcases - ${count_errors} errors - \ ${count_failures} failures<br> append=${TRUE}
Delete Current MUnit Log
[Documentation] Deletes MUnit Log File, stored in test variable ``${CURRENT_MUNIT_LOG_FNAME}``.
...
... Can be used in test teardown, e.g. in combination with _Run Keyword If Test Failed_ .
...
... see also `Get MUnit Log File Name from Test Runner Output`
Run Keyword And Ignore Error Remove File ${CURRENT_MUNIT_LOG_FNAME}
Set Test Variable ${CURRENT_MUNIT_LOG_LINK} ${EMPTY}
[Teardown] Set Test Variable ${CURRENT_MUNIT_LOG_FNAME} ${EMPTY}
